Ingredients:
- 1 pizza dough store-bought or homemade
- 1/2 pound thinly sliced ribeye steak
- 1/2 cup sliced green bell peppers
- 1/2 cup sliced onions
- 1 cup shredded provolone cheese
- 1/2 cup sliced mushrooms
- 1/4 cup pizza sauce
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- 1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/4 teaspoon red pepper flakes optional
- Fresh parsley for garnish
Instructions:
Set your oven to 475F 245C and put a baking sheet or pizza stone inside to heat up
Put the olive oil in a pan and heat it over medium-high heat
It will take about two to three minutes of cooking after adding the steak slices until they are browned
Take the steak out of the pan and set it aside
Put the mushrooms, green bell peppers, and onions that have been sliced into the same pan
You can add salt, black pepper, garlic powder, and red pepper flakes to taste
It will take about 5 to 7 minutes of sauting until the vegetables are soft and slightly caramelized
On a lightly floured surface, roll out the pizza dough to the thickness you want
Carefully move the dough to a piece of parchment paper if you are using a pizza stone
Spread the pizza sauce out evenly on the dough, but leave a little space around the edges for the crust
On top of the sauce, put half of the provolone cheese
Spread the cooked steak and vegetables in a pan over the cheese in an even layer
Add the rest of the provolone cheese to the steak and vegetables
Carefully move the pizza from the parchment paper to the hot pizza stone or baking sheet in the oven that has already been heated
Put it in the oven for 10 to 12 minutes, or until the crust is golden brown and the cheese is bubbly and a little browned
After taking the Philly Cheesesteak Pizza out of the oven, sprinkle it with fresh parsley, cut it up, and serve it hot
